We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 1c09779 + d322ca2 commit 04c6f55Copy full SHA for 04c6f55
unittests/data/core_class_hierarchy.hpp
@@ -6,8 +6,6 @@
6
#ifndef __core_class_hierarchy_hpp__
7
#define __core_class_hierarchy_hpp__
8
9
-//TODO("To add virtual inheritance case");
10
-
11
namespace core{ namespace class_hierarchy{
12
13
class base_t{
@@ -24,10 +22,10 @@ class derived_public_t : public base_t{
24
22
class derived_protected_t : protected base_t{
25
23
};
26
27
-class derived_private_t : private base_t{
+class derived_private_t : private virtual base_t{
28
29
30
-class multi_derived_t : derived_private_t, protected base_t, private other_base_t{
+class multi_derived_t : derived_private_t, protected virtual base_t, private other_base_t{
31
32
33
} }
0 commit comments